// Acorn is a tiny, fast JavaScript parser written in JavaScript. // // Acorn was written by Marijn Haverbeke, Ingvar Stepanyan, and // various contributors and released under an MIT license. // // Git repositories for Acorn are available at // // http://marijnhaverbeke.nl/git/acorn // https://github.com/ternjs/acorn.git // // Please use the [github bug tracker][ghbt] to report issues. // // [ghbt]: https://github.com/ternjs/acorn/issues // // This file defines the main parser interface. The library also comes // with a [error-tolerant parser][dammit] and an // [abstract syntax tree walker][walk], defined in other files. // // [dammit]: acorn_loose.js // [walk]: util/walk.js import {Parser} from "./state" import "./parseutil" import "./statement" import "./lval" import "./expression" import "./location" export {Parser, plugins} from "./state" export {defaultOptions} from "./options" export {Position, SourceLocation, getLineInfo} from "./locutil" export {Node} from "./node" export {TokenType, types as tokTypes} from "./tokentype" export {TokContext, types as tokContexts} from "./tokencontext" export {isIdentifierChar, isIdentifierStart} from "./identifier" export {Token} from "./tokenize" export {isNewLine, lineBreak, lineBreakG} from "./whitespace" export const version = "2.7.0" // The main exported interface (under `self.acorn` when in the // browser) is a `parse` function that takes a code string and // returns an abstract syntax tree as specified by [Mozilla parser // API][api]. // // [api]: https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/SpiderMonkey/Parser_API export function parse(input, options) { return new Parser(options, input).parse() } // This function tries to parse a single expression at a given // offset in a string. Useful for parsing mixed-language formats // that embed JavaScript expressions. export function parseExpressionAt(input, pos, options) { let p = new Parser(options, input, pos) p.nextToken() return p.parseExpression() } // Acorn is organized as a tokenizer and a recursive-descent parser. // The `tokenizer` export provides an interface to the tokenizer. export function tokenizer(input, options) { return new Parser(options, input) }
